Witryna1 sty 2003 · Abstract. In the United States, three third-generation aromatase inhibitors are available commercially: anastrozole, letrozole, and exemestane. Anastrozole and letrozole are nonsteroidal agents, whereas exemestane is a steroid. Witryna30 lip 2012 · The antiestrogenic effects of luteolin consist of the inhibition of estrogen synthesis by decreasing aromatase expression and destabilizing aromatase [32]. In the same way than quercetin and ... WitrynaIn the present study, we compared the efficacy of the flavonoid luteolin to the clinically approved AI letrozole (Femara®) in a cell and a mouse model. In the in vitro experimental results for aromatase inhibition, the Ki values of luteolin and letrozole were estimated to be 2.44 µM and 0.41 nM, respectively.

WitrynaThe Chinese discovered that luteolin may indeed be one of these naturally occurring substances. They screened 1431 natural compounds and discovered that luteolin was the most powerful aromatase inhibitor. Luteolin is a flavonoid that we consume daily via foods such as celery, green paprika and peppers, onions, parsley, cabbage and …
